On this page we show you how to reset the Dlink DIR-605L router back to the original factory defaults. This is not the same thing as a reboot. When you reboot something you end up only cycling the power to the device. When you reset a router you take all the settings and return them all to factory defaults.
Warning: Resetting your router is a big step and should be carefully considered first. We have started a list of settings that are reverted:
- The router's main username and password.
- The Internet name and password.
- The ISP (Internet Service Provider) username and password if you use a DSL connection.
- Have you made any other changes to your router such as parental controls or filters? These all need to be setup again after the reset is complete.

Reset the Dlink DIR-605L
As you can see from the image below the reset button is located on the back panel on the right side.

With the router on press and hold the reset button for about 10 seconds. This begins the reset process. Make sure you hold the reset button down for the entire amount of time. If you don't you end up only rebooting the router instead of resetting it like you wanted.
Don't forget that this reset erases every single setting you have ever changed. If you want to avoid that you need to try other troubleshooting methods.
Login to the Dlink DIR-605L
Once you've reset the Dlink DIR-605L router you should log into it. This is done by using the factory default username and password provided to you in our Login Guide.
Tip: If the defaults aren't working for you it may be because the reset button wasn't held down for long enough.
Change Your Password
Following that you should set a password for your router. This can be whatever you like, however keep in mind that a strong password consists of 14-20 characters and includes no personal information. For more help be sure to take a look through our Choosing a Strong Password Guide.
Tip: Avoid losing your new password by writing it on a sticky note and putting it on the underside of your router.
